  • Although never demonstrated in humans, exchange of the antigen-binding regions of IgG4 antibodies with different specificities could complicate certain antibody therapies. Labrijn et al. show that Fab-arm exchange occurs in patients and propose that a single mutation can inhibit the process.

  • Labrijn et al. describe the generation of bispecific antibodies through controlled Fab-arm exchange, involving separate expression of two parental IgG1s containing single matching point mutations, followed by recombination of the 'half molecules'.
